What problem does it solve?

This Skill helps users analyze data accurately by applying statistical methods for understanding distributions, identifying trends, detecting anomalies, and evaluating whether observed differences are meaningful.

Core Features & Use Cases

  • Descriptive Statistics: Summarize datasets with appropriate measures of center, spread, percentiles, and distribution characteristics.
  • Trend and Anomaly Analysis: Identify patterns over time, detect unusual values, and apply practical forecasting approaches.
  • Hypothesis Testing Guidance: Evaluate experiments, comparisons, and business metrics while accounting for significance, effect size, and statistical limitations.
  • Use Case: Analyze product metrics to determine whether an A/B test improvement is statistically meaningful or whether a change may be caused by random variation.
